Message type: E = Error
Message class: RTST_OP - Messages for Retail Store Order Products application
Message number: 024
Message text: Factory calendar &1 of store &2 does not exist

- Factory calendar &1 of store &2 does not exist ?The SAP error message RTST_OP024 indicates that the system is unable to find the specified factory calendar for a particular store. This error typically arises in the context of planning and scheduling operations, where a factory calendar is essential for determining working days, holidays, and other relevant scheduling information.
Cause:
- Missing Factory Calendar: The factory calendar specified for the store does not exist in the system.
- Incorrect Configuration: The store may be incorrectly configured, leading to a reference to a non-existent factory calendar.
- Data Migration Issues: If data has been migrated from another system, the factory calendar may not have been transferred correctly.
-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ary permissions to access the factory calendar data.
Solution:
Check Factory Calendar Configuration:
- Go to the configuration settings in SAP and verify if the factory calendar for the specified store exists.
- You can check this in the transaction code
SCAL
(Maintain Factory Calendar) or through the relevant customizing path in SPRO.Create or Assign Factory Calendar:
- If the factory calendar does not exist, you may need to create a new factory calendar or assign an existing one to the store.
- Ensure that the factory calendar is correctly defined with the necessary working days and holidays.
Review Store Configuration:
- Check the configuration of the store in the relevant module (e.g., Retail, Logistics) to ensure that it is correctly linked to the appropriate factory calendar.
Data Consistency Check:
- If data migration is involved, perform a consistency check to ensure that all necessary data, including factory calendars, has been migrated correctly.
Authorization Check:
- Ensure that the user encountering the error has the necessary authorizations to access the factory calendar data.
